Error al grabar

jorg
23 de Agosto del 2004
He hecho una funcion para q cuando pulses un boton brabe el contenido de un textbox en la bdd.Al pulsar me dice q grabar no esta definido.Alguien m podria decir x q?CODIGO:

<?php
function grabar() {
//Conecto bdd
mysql_connect($Servidor, $Usuario, $Clave);

//Creamos la sentencia sql
mysql_db_query("incosol","insert into contacto (id,respond,respond_por,respuest,confirmado) values ('$id','$respondido','$respondido_por','$respuesta','$confirmado') ");
$sSQL="Update contacto Set respondido='$respondido', respondido_por='$respondido_por', respuesta='$respuesta', confirmado='$confirmado' Where id='$id'";
mysql_db_query("incosol",$sSQL);
}
?>
<div id="Layer3" style="position:absolute; left:192px; top:127px; width:592px; height:447px; z-index:3">

<table width="100%">
<form name="formulario" method="post" action="mail.php" >
<tr><td align=center colspan=4 class="titseccion">Detalle de Contacto</td></tr>
<tr>
<td align="right">Apellido&nbsp;1&nbsp;(*):&nbsp;</td>
<td><?php echo $contacto->getValor("apellido1") ?></td>
<td align="right">Apellido&nbsp;2:&nbsp;</td>
<td><?php echo $contacto->getValor("apellido2"); ?></td>
</tr>
<tr>
<td align="right">Nombre&nbsp;(*):&nbsp;</td>
<td><?php echo $contacto->getValor("nombre"); ?></td>
<td align="right">E-mail&nbsp;(*):&nbsp;</td>
<td><?php echo $contacto->getValor("email"); ?></td>
</tr>
<tr>
<td align="right">Consulta</td>
<td colspan="3" align="center"><?php echo $contacto->getValor("asunto"); ?></td>
</tr>
</table><br>

<table width="100%">
<tr><td align=center colspan=4 class="titseccion">Contestacion</td></tr>
<tr>
<td width="25%" align="right">Respondido&nbsp;Sí/No:&nbsp;</td>
<td width="50%"><select name="respondido" id="respondido">
<option><?php echo $contacto->getValor("respondido") ?></option>
<option>No</option>
<option>Si</option>
</select></td>
</tr>
<tr>
<td align="right">Respondido por:&nbsp;</td>
<td><select name="respondido_por" id="respondido_por">
<option><?php echo $contacto->getValor("respondido_por") ?></option>
<option>Mª Angeles</option>
<option>Mª José Jiménez</option>
<option>Antonio</option>
<option>Eva</option>
<option>Mª José</option>
</select></td>
</tr>
<tr>
<td align="center">Respuesta:&nbsp;<br><br>
<input style='width:90pt' align="center" type="button" class="boton" value="Grabar sin Enviar" onDblClick="grabar"></td>
<td><textarea id="respuesta" name="respuesta" value="" cols=35 rows=10 /><?php echo $contacto->getValor("respuesta") ?></textarea></td>
</tr>
<tr>
<td align="right">Reserva&nbsp;Confirmada?&nbsp;</td>
<td><select name="confirmado" id="confirmado">
<option><?php echo $contacto->getValor("confirmado") ?></option>
<option>No</option>
<option>Si</option>
</select></td>
</tr>
<tr>

<td colspan="4" align="center">
<input style='width:80pt' align="left" type="submit" class="boton" value="Grabar y Enviar">
</table>

<input id="id" name="id" type="hidden" value="<?php echo $id ?>" />
<input id="destinatario" name="destinatario" type="hidden" value="<?php echo $email ?>" />

</form>

</div>